How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Strawberry Hill?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Strawberry Hill Studio Apartments | $2,840 | $1,650 | $5,984 |
Strawberry Hill 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,174 | $1,300 | $8,652 |
Strawberry Hill 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,692 | $1,325 | $10,000+ |
Strawberry Hill 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,010 | $1,000 | $10,000+ |
Strawberry Hill 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,624 | $925 | $10,000+ |
Strawberry Hill 5 Bedroom Apartments | $5,614 | $875 | $8,500 |
Strawberry Hill 6 Bedroom Apartments | $6,475 | $800 | $10,000+ |

Getting Around the Strawberry Hill Neighborhood in Cambridge, MA
Walk Score®
86 / 100
Very Walkable
Most errands can be accomplished on foot
Bike Score®
92 / 100
Biker's Paradise
Daily errands can be accomplished on a bike
Transit Score®
47 / 100
Some Transit
A few nearby public transportation options
What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
